AGENDA TITLE: Award Contract for Granular Activated Carbon Filter Systems for Wells No. 18 and 20 ($731,760)
MEETING DATE: January 20, 1999
PREPARED BY: Public Works Director
RECOMMENDED ACTION: That the City Council adopt the attached resolution awarding the contract for the above
project to Rutherford and Smith, of Sacramento, in the amount of $731,755, and appropriate
funds in accordance with the recommendation shown below.
BACKGROUND INFORMATION: As part of the City of Lodi's DBCP litigation settlement, money was received to pay for
the design and construction of Granular Activated Carbon (GAC) Filters at water well
sites 18 and 20. Well 18 is located at the intersection of Church Street and
Century Boulevard. Well 20's address is 2126 West Kettleman Lane. The settlement
agreement also stated that the City must install GAC filters at water well sites 18 and 20 before the City would receive any
further funding for GAC filters at other water well sites. The GAC vessels will be a "low profile" design similar to the vessels
at Well 16 (Beckman Park).
Plans and specifications for this project were approved on December 18, 1996, when Council approved the hiring of Brown
and Caldwell to prepare the plans and specifications. The City received the following eleven bids for this project:
